Around 14 exhibitors from Pakistan will showcase their products at the world's largest consumer goods show `Ambiente', scheduled to be held at Frankfurt from February 10 to 14, 2017. The Pakistani organisations and companies likely to participate in the show include Trade Development Authority of Pakistan (TDAP), Balochistan Glass Limited, Civil Metal Works, Clay Works, East-West Connection, Euro Metal, Fatima Enterprises, Majestic Chef, Pakistan Souvenirs, Paras Industries, R & D Precision (Pvt) Limited, Sana Traders, Sharp Edge Enterprises & Tariq Glass Limited.
The Pakistani exhibitors would display their products, including interior decoration items, handicrafts, kitchen accessories and several other consumer goods. 4,356 exhibitors from 96 countries will present trends and innovations at the exhibition for the coming business season. The trade fair offers a unique opportunity to traders and businessmen for showcasing their products such as kitchen accessories, house wares, gift and decorative items, furniture, besides presenting their concepts concerning interior décor and designing.
